Information Embedding by Multiple Components Based on Lifting of the Color Space of an Image Masataka Yamazaki, Mitsugu Kakuta, Yukio Kosugi (Tokyo Tech.) |
Abstract |
(in Japanese) |
(See Japanese page) |
(in English) |
The data structure of a RGB color image is utilized by the information embedding based on KL (Karhunen Loeve) transformation of color space.In three components obtained by the transformation, embedding using the smallest component of the eigen value is performed.Moreover, the embedded watermark is unevenly distributed to the part in image space.The previous work [12] showed that an embedding image that does not spoil the quality of a color image was created using this character.Furthermore, by this method, a component suitable for embedding increases with the rise of the number of dimensions of component data obtained by transformation of color space.In this paper, we propose embedding a different watermark using two or more components.An experiment shows an embedding result.Moreover, the analysis result based on the eigen value of an original color image is also shown. |
